About

Dr. Akintunde Akinleye, MD is a Hematology Specialist in Danville, VA and has 21 years experience. They graduated from XINXIANG MEDICAL COLLEGE. They currently practice at Practice and are affiliated with ECU Health Roanoke-Chowan Hospital and Sovah Health Danville. Dr. Akinleye has experience treating conditions like Anemia, Myeloproliferative Disorders and Thrombocytosis among other conditions at varying frequencies. At present, Dr. Akinleye received an average rating of 3.0/5 from patients and has been reviewed 2 times. Their office is not accepting new patients. Dr. Akinleye is board certified in Hematology and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
